Job Search in Georgia

The job search process for foreigners in Georgia is quite standard, and it can be done online or through speculative communications.

Finding work in Tbilisi or any of the other cities will be challenging if you are not a teacher. It is worthwhile to immediately contact the foreign corporations that operate in the country to see whether they have any job openings. They are unlikely to post open positions for foreigners, preferring to hire locals, so approaching them personally will give you a higher chance of getting a job. Make certain that you have done your homework and that your abilities and experience apply to the teams they have working in Georgia.

Georgia Working Visa and Resident Permit

Working Visas and Residents Permit Visas for expats working in Georgia are difficult to obtain. You could formerly stay in Georgia for up to 360 days without acquiring a resident’s permission. As a result, numerous firms gave, and continue to offer, work to people on visitor visas. Despite the fact that many internet resources claim you don’t need a special visa to work and earn money in the country, working on a normal tourist visa is banned in most cases.

The uncertainty is most likely the result of a change in Georgian visa policy in late 2014. Tourists, freelancers working in the country, journalists, and those attending business meetings and conferences can now enter the country on a standard Tourist visa. If you want to work in Georgia, start a business, or give paid services to a Georgian corporation, you must travel on a long-term visa. Various documents are necessary for such a visa application, depending on the reason for your stay. A long-term visa is also required to get a resident permit.

A tourist visa allows you to stay in the country for 30 days and is only valid for one entry. If you are visiting before moving and anticipate crossing the border, you will need to secure a long-term visa that allows numerous entries into the nation.
